Default Thai Airways ATR 72-200 HS-TRB

Just released: Thai Airways ATR 72-200 HS-TRB o/c with King´s 72nd anniversary colours 1:500

This is another work of Tobias who did most of the graphic design of this model. Base model was Herpa Vietnam Airlines ATR 72 #508032. Hope you like it. Any comments are welcome.
